Control cabinets for automation systems

Control cabinets and automation equipment based on automation systems are a set of cabinets that control a complete technological process or a separate part of it, with the ability to integrate into existing APCS systems.

Automation systems can be either local, to control a separate system, or top-level ones that combine several processes or circuits.

Power and distribution cabinets transmit data on the state of the executive systems and receive control commands from the top-level controller and/or process operator’s workstation.

Cabinets and automation systems can be used in automation of cycles and continuous processes, as well as separate production steps.

Application Scope

  • Automation of workflow in industry (control and regulation of process parameters, process supervision, unit/installation automation).
  • Automated water supply and drainage (water intakes, lift pumping stations, wastewater pumping and treatment stations, sewage pumping stations).
  • Automated heat supply systems (TPP, boiler houses, heating points).
  • Automated gas supply systems (gas control points, gas control stations, gas control installations).
  • Smart-houses (heating, ventilation and air conditioning, water supply and sewerage, gas supply, power supply, fire extinguishing and smoke removal systems).
